Mary Innes Shepley

February 21, 1927 ~ April 6, 2018 (age 91) 91 Years Old

Tribute

Mary Innes Shepley passed away at the Royal Westerly Nursing home on April 6, 2018.

Mary was born in 1927 in the Bronx, New York as the eldest daughter of David Dingwall and Mary (Mason) Dingwall. Mary was brought up in Newport, Rhode Island where she attended Rogers High School and graduated in the class of 1945.

Mary graduated from Rhode Island College (later became URI) with a teaching degree and a bachelors in Home Economics. She became a sister of the Alpha Delta Pi Sorority while attending college. Upon graduating, some of her initial student teaching was in Westerly, Rhode Island. Her first full teaching position was in Danbury, Connecticut.

Mary married William I Shepley, Jr at the Trinity Church in Newport, R.I. in 1950.

After they moved to New Jersey, Mary taught Home Economics in the Montgomery School system. She was an avid member of Neshanic Garden Club while living in Skillman, New Jersey.

After retirement, Mary and her husband retired to their cottage in Jamestown, Rhode Island. Mary became an active member of the Quononoquott Garden Club.

Mary is survived by her son, William Bruce Shepley of Oregon and her daughters, Susan Innes Shepley of Connecticut and Jean Ellen Paterson of New Jersey. She has three grandchildren; Nancy Paterson, David Shepley, and Colin Shepley as well as three step-grandchildren; Jonathan Paterson, Ryan Paterson, and Kathy Paterson.

Mary is predeceased by her husband, and her brothers, David Dingwall and James Dingwall as well as her sister Elizabeth Crosby.

Mary enjoyed being a people person, gardening, fishing, and her family.
